Transaction 70407d897863c32664c4c1d332a1f93122641fb6379bfec9069ed018f72b2a38
1 Input
2 Outputs
- 70407d897863c32664c4c1d332a1f93122641fb6379bfec9069ed018f72b2a38:0
- 70407d897863c32664c4c1d332a1f93122641fb6379bfec9069ed018f72b2a38:1
value 10540000
address 3AVL8x4zNjTuBxpQoDzyVKU5sztr3FWREc
value 16571284
address 196i9SG3ZHnZnfgZgrEz2pELAzEjLL8ku8